What Are the Best Ayurveda Retreats in India? How Can They Improve Health, Wellness, and Healing? - #13818

James

I’m interested in going to one of the best Ayurveda retreats in India to improve my health and experience healing. I’ve heard that these retreats provide a mix of Panchakarma, Ayurvedic massages, detox programs, and yoga to help with stress management, physical health, and overall well-being. What makes a retreat stand out, and which ones offer the most effective Ayurvedic treatments for detox, relaxation, and mental clarity? How are Ayurvedic retreats in India structured, and what can I expect from a typical retreat package? Are the treatments tailored to individual health concerns, such as immune support, skin care, or digestive health? If anyone has visited one of the best Ayurveda retreats in India, please share your experience. What treatments did you receive, and how did they help with wellness, detoxification, or immunity boosting?

ndia is home to some of the best Ayurvedic retreats that offer a range of holistic treatments to promote detoxification, stress relief, and overall well-being. Here’s what you can expect:

Common Ayurvedic Retreat Offerings: Panchakarma Detox: A deep cleansing therapy that eliminates toxins and rejuvenates the body. Abhyanga (Oil Massage): Full-body massage using medicated oils to reduce stress and improve circulation. Shirodhara: A soothing treatment where warm oil is poured on the forehead to promote mental clarity. Yoga & Meditation: Daily sessions to balance the mind and body. Dietary Plans: Customized sattvic meals to promote digestion and overall health. Tailored Treatments: Most retreats offer personalized treatments based on dosha imbalances and individual health concerns. Whether you’re looking to improve digestion, boost immunity, or manage stress, treatments are often tailored to your specific needs.

Ayurveda retreats in India are renowned for their holistic approach to health and well-being, offering personalized treatments such as Panchakarma, Ayurvedic massages, detox programs, and yoga to promote physical, mental, and emotional healing. What makes a retreat stand out is its focus on individual health concerns and the expertise of Ayurvedic practitioners who tailor treatments to your specific needs, such as immune support, skin care, stress relief, and digestive health. Retreats in India often begin with a consultation to assess your health and dosha type, and based on this, a tailored program is designed. A typical retreat package includes daily Ayurvedic therapies, detox treatments, herbal remedies, nutritious Ayurvedic meals, and yoga sessions. Many retreats also offer meditation and stress management techniques to enhance mental clarity and emotional balance.

The most effective Ayurvedic retreats, such as those in Kerala, Rishikesh, and Goa, focus on detoxification (through Panchakarma), relaxation, and rejuvenation. These treatments help cleanse the body of toxins, improve circulation, enhance immunity, and support the digestive system. You can expect a serene and healing environment that fosters deep relaxation and transformation. The treatments aim to restore balance to your body and mind, using Ayurvedic herbs, oils, and techniques specific to your health concerns.

Visitors to these retreats often report feeling rejuvenated, with improved digestion, enhanced immunity, reduced stress, and a greater sense of clarity and well-being. The experience is deeply immersive, and benefits are often felt over a period of days to weeks, depending on the treatments and the individual’s health goals. With the right guidance from Ayurvedic practitioners, these retreats can provide lasting improvements to your overall health.

Choosing an Ayurveda retreat can be transformative for your health and wellbeing. It’s great you are considering retreats that focus on Panchakarma, massages, and yoga – they really can work wonders. Standout retreats usually offer personalized programs based on your dosha, and balance is key in Ayurveda, remember. Look for retreats with experienced vaidyas (Ayurvedic doctors) who take into account your unique prakriti (constitution), analyze agni (digestive fire), and specific health concerns.

Some top retreats include Ananda in the Himalayas, Somatheeram Ayurvedic Health Resort in Kerala, and Vana Retreat in Dehradun. These places are known for their authentic treatments and experienced staff. Ananda, for example, is nestled in the tranquility of the Himalayas and offers a holistic blend of traditional Ayurveda and luxury. Somatheeram is famed for its classic Ayurvedic therapies, rooted in strong traditions.

Now, retreats are usually structured around your ayurvedic profile and goals. They begin with a consultation to assess your health. Then comes a customized plan which might include detoxifying Panchakarma, diet modifications, and group or solo yoga sessions. Expect everyday schedules to be full, yet rejuvenating – morning yoga, followed by therapy sessions, maybe an afternoon lecture or meditation.

These treatments are definitely tailored to individual concerns. Say if you’ve skin issues, focus might be on treatments involving herbal pastes and oils or dietary changes. For digestive health, you may undergo specific detox procedures and consume easily digestible foods.

In terms of personal experience, many mention feeling an improvement in stress levels, better digestion, clearer skin, or strengthened immunity post-treatment. Someone visiting Somatheeram shared how Panchakarma left their mind clearer and contributed to weight loss.

Remember though, it’s essential to have realistic expectations and communicate clearly your health goals. A good retreat focuses as much on prevention as on cure, by restoring balance and boosting vitality.
